CSMS# 09-000364 – HSU 0904: Changes to the 2009/2010 Harmonized Tariff Schedule
Fri, 11 Dec 2009 06:19:57 -0600
Automated Broker Interface
Harmonized System Update (HSU) 0904 was created on December 10, 2009 and contains 40,159 ABI records and 6,479 harmonized tariff records.
This update includes the annual special program staged rate reductions for 2010.
In addition, this update contains changes made as a result of the Committee for Statistical Annotation of Tariff Schedules, the 484(F) Committee. The revisions take effect on January 1, 2010, and include a request by the USDA (United States Department of Agriculture) to report milk solids content of dairy products in the kilogram unit of measure. Dairy related tariff numbers, which are subject to the reporting of milk solids content of dairy products, will have a second reporting unit of measure indicating ‘CKG’ (Content in Kilograms). The ‘CKG’ indication refers to the weight in kilograms associated with the milk solids content.
Potato import assessment increases mandated by the Agricultural Marketing Service (AMS) are included as well. These adjustments were effective on December 7, 2009.
Finally, this update contains changes required by the verification of the 2009 Harmonized Tariff Schedule (HTS).
The modified records are currently available to all ABI participants and can be retrieved electronically via the procedures indicated in the CATAIR. S# 09-000361 – Pending Importer Security Filing (ISF) Changes
Fri, 04 Dec 2009 15:40:59 -0600
Ocean Manifest
On October 15, 2009, CSMS #09-000326 was issued describing changes to the SF90 record and the ISF error code list. These changes will become effective on Saturday, December 12, 2009. The CUSRES document was also mentioned in this CSMS message as a response to the BAPLIE stow plan. The use of the CUSRES will NOT begin on December 12, 2009. A message will be sent in advance of CUSRES responses being sent to parties filing BAPLIEs.
Additionally, ISF transactions using a flexibility option will receive a response notifying the filer that the ISF needs to be updated with a complete ISF transaction. The filer would receive the notification whenever the action reason code is ‘FR’, ‘FT’, or ‘FX’. The only complete transaction would include a ‘CT’ action reason code.
This also serves as a reminder to file ISF transactions using the lowest bill level as either a house bill or a simple bill. Filing an ISF with the wrong bill number or wrong bill type will result in a ‘No Bill on File’ message being sent.

CSMS# 09-000362 – ACE Portal Account Applications – Apply Now!
Wed, 09 Dec 2009 10:25:44 -0600
Automated Broker Interface
It has come to our attention that some trade members have the understanding that applications for ACE Portal Accounts are no longer being accepted and processed by CBP. CBP would like to clarify that CBP is accepting applications for ACE Portal Accounts on a continuing basis.
